Title:
  Make the 'People online' block collapsable

Status in Mahara:
  Triaged

Bug description:
  The suggestion is to make the 'People online' side block collapsable
  so that you can decide to show people or not (see attached
  screenshot). This is a useful option when you don't want to turn the
  block off entirely, but don't want to show names in that block during
  a training session or video recording.

  A code suggestion is attached.

  For implementation into core Mahara the following should be considered:
  - Use our normal chevrons for collapsing instead of the two arrows in the 
picture.
  - Could we use our normal card so as to get the chevrons directly?
  - The collapsing should be sticky, i.e. remember the last state so one 
doesn't have to close it all the time when one just wants it closed for more 
than a page.

  The attached code has some colour values hard-coded, which shouldn't
  be the case for Mahara core.
